Output 5d232d38cdf320faab5c35c47e08f5f938eb6ce9d97a27142743299c35ddd34b:2

value
3137941433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a2c1e40f996266800b2a55698f7916a99774c8c OP_EQUAL
address
3BNQQGBcGbbbhpSWxh4a7aLuLBo5pkfHVE
transaction
5d232d38cdf320faab5c35c47e08f5f938eb6ce9d97a27142743299c35ddd34b
confirmations
439417
spent
true